a fiber cut at 14:37 utc on june 22 knocked cloudflare-dependent services offline simultaneously, including x, zoom, microsoft teams, reddit, aws, square, and canva, briefly disrupting what cloudflare estimated as half of internet traffic. the incident is structurally notable not because of the cut itself but because a single upstream physical failure propagated through so many nominally independent services at once, revealing the degree to which internet service diversity has collapsed into a small number of shared backbone dependencies.
